God Is Omnipotent (All Powerful)
God calls Himself the Almighty many times throughout the Bible Genesis 17:1; 35:11, etc). He has all the power there is, and no being can exercise any power unless God allows it (Romans 13:1). Again, only God is omnipotent, for only one being can have all power. 1Timothy 6:15 describes God as "the blessed and only Potentate, the King of kings, and Lord of lords." The saints of God in heaven will proclaim "Alleluia: for the Lord God omnipotent reigneth" (Revelation 19:6). God beautifully describes His great omnipotence in Job 38:41.[/b]
The only limitations God has are those He willingly places on Himself or those resulting from His moral nature. Since He is holy and sinless, He abides by His own moral character . . . .therefore it is impossible for God to lie or contradict His own Word (Titus 1:2; Hebrews 6:18).[/b]
